Output eb229409030b308927f4247a1552a604d8cfca4b7f9f054f156e55a9e4816663:3

value
12475590
script pubkey
OP_0 OP_PUSHBYTES_20 ea241e435099166f0749a6b30bbf5588495c287d
address
ltc1qagjpus6snytx7p6f56esh0643py4c2rakgh5h5
transaction
eb229409030b308927f4247a1552a604d8cfca4b7f9f054f156e55a9e4816663
spent
true